Black Lentil and Bean Tex-Mex Burgers with Guacamole 

Our Mexican style burger is packed with all your favourite Tex-Mex flavours; black beans, guac, sour cream, cheese and lots of flavour! A perfect meal idea for the weekend.

Serves 4
10 mins prep time
15 mins cook time

Ingredients

1 packet of The Spice Tailor Delhi Black Lentil Daal (lentils included)
1 tbsp. vegetable oil
40-50g of dried breadcrumbs
150g canned black beans or kidney beans, drained
2 small handfuls of chopped fresh coriander, leaves and stalks
1 ripe avocado, chopped up
3 tbsp. chopped red onion
2 small tomatoes, 1 chopped and 1 sliced
lemon juice
Few leaves of baby gem lettuce or other
Seasoning to taste
4 burger buns
Optional, but recommended, toppings
Cheese slices, pickled jalapenos and sour cream.

Method

Step one

Place the contents of both packs from the daal kit (setting aside the spices) in a saucepan. Add the black beans and cook over a moderate heat, stirring often until the lentils have thickened up, around 6-7 minutes. Stir in half the coriander and 2 tbs. chopped onion and 35g of the crumbs and stir together. This will thicken slightly as it cools. Add some more crumbs in case it isn’t firm enough to form into burgers (it depends on how much you reduced them in the pan).

Step two

Whilst they are cooling, make the topping by mashing the avocado, chopped tomato and remaining onion and coriander and lemon juice. Season well or to taste.

Step three

Once the beans are cool enough, make into four even-sized burgers and press directly into the remaining crumbs to coat on both sides. As you make the first, they should be firm, if they aren’t add more crumbs to the mix.

Step four

Heat the oil in a frying pan and fry gently until golden on both sides, around 2 minutes per side. For example, you could add the cheese slice on the upper, cooked side after the first flip and let it soften as the second side cooks.

Step five

Toast your buns and spread the bottom half with some sour cream, then add sliced tomato and lettuce leaves, top with the burgers and then a generous amount of the guacamole, some pickled jalapenos and finally the top bun half. Serve!

Please ensure food is cooked through and piping hot before serving.

Made with our delicious Delhi Black Lentil Daal 

Our Delhi Black Lentil Daal is inspired by ‘Makhani Daal’, which is a popular North Indian dish. The reason for its popularity becomes obvious once you taste the soft, buttery black lentils nestled in the velvety smooth sauce. The dish is enriched with a blend of aromatic spices, tangy tomato and warming ginger and is made even more mouthwatering with the addition of cream and butter.

This warming and nutty Delhi-inspired daal comes complete with lentils and whole spices. Enjoy as a main with rice or naan, or serve as a side dish.
